1. CHI's operating loss swells to $153.9M in Q2
Catholic Health Initiatives, a nonprofit 103-hospital system based in Englewood, Colo., saw revenue increase in the second quarter of fiscal year 2017 but ended the period with an operating loss, according to recently released bondholder documents.

2. Bermuda government accuses Lahey of bribing island's former leader
Bermuda filed a federal lawsuit against Boston-based Lahey Hospital & Medical Center accusing the hospital group of bribing the island's former leader in exchange for preferential treatment in winning government healthcare contracts.

3. Allina Health's nursing strike costs reached $149M in 2016
Minneapolis-based Allina Health saw revenues increase in 2016, but the 13-hospital system's operating income plummeted in the 12 months that ended Dec. 31.

4. CHI St. Luke's closes facilities, cuts 89 jobs
Houston-based CHI St. Luke's Health closed two emergency centers Feb. 10, affecting 89 jobs.

5. House conservatives push for standalone ACA repeal
Several dozen House conservatives are drumming up support to ditch the "repeal-plus" plan for the ACA and move ahead with a repeal bill, sans replacement.

6. Ex-hospital administrator faces up to 70 years in prison for role in kickback scheme
A federal jury found a former administrator of Shreveport, La.-based Physicians Behavioral Hospital — a 24-bed facility that offers psychiatric and chemical dependency treatment — guilty Thursday of 14 counts of paying illegal kickbacks.

7. Founding family of Cleveland Clinic denounces health system's Mar-a-Lago fundraiser
The Crile family — of Cleveland Clinic Co-founder George Washington Crile, MD — spoke out against the health system's plan to host a fundraiser at President Donald Trump's Mar-a-Lago Club in Florida.
